Octamer-4 (Oct-4), a member of the POU family of transcription factors, has been demonstrated to be vital for the formation of self-renewing pluripotent stem cells.
During embryogenesis, expression of Oct-4 is limited to pluripotent cells of the inner cell mass (ICM) that contribute to the formation of all fetal cell types.
